Description: controls tape autochangers
 MTX can be used to manipulate tape auto-changers, also known as "jukeboxes",
 such that backup software can make use of the multiple tape capabilities of
 the auto-changer.  In particular, this is necessary glue for using a backup
 system like Amanda with a DDS auto-changer like the HP Surestore 12000e.
